Scottie wrote:well I've spontaneously found 3 weeks leave for a euro taster!

why just 3 weeks? well, work demands n such.
why not wait? I have 2 mates over there currently wanting me to go meet them, and an opportune contract gap gives me a little time.

so Sco-tie is going to start in London town, stay in england for 5 days or so, then go via the Nurburgring to Milan for the GP. Topping it all off with a visit to Monte Carlo.

any tips on those places, where to stay or if anyone want's to catch up while I'm there, feel free!

I'll arrive on the PM of August 28th and leave in Sept 17th ex-Milan :)

Scottie's Excited!%#*@#

Stay in the town of Monza, there should be plenty of accomodation there its about the size of adelaide minus the skyscrapers(or what adeladians would call skyscrapers). Though on GP Italy week it might be tricky I guess. Monza is one of the prettiest places I have ever been to, the track is also absolutely amazing. You will love it Scottie!
